The geese are still flying over Sewerby, 9th November 2014

You can identify in flight by calls;

'A-honk'. Canada
'Wink wink' Pinkfeet.
'Gung-gung(or similar) Greylag.

I would think Canada is most likely though. If it was Flamingo Park they could be Barnacles too, but it isn't near there is it?
 
Well, they certainly seem to honk. No, Sewerby is not that near to Kirby Misperton - it's 35 to 40 miles away or thereabouts.
 
I would think Canadas. I don't think Yorkshire is a Pinkfeet wintering area like e.g. Norfolk is.
